National Assembly and the business community gathered to discuss cooperative measures for economic revitalization and solving social challenges.
On the 23rd, Speaker of the National Assembly, Woo Won-shik, visited the Korea Chamber of Commerce and Industry (KCCI) in Jung-gu, Seoul, and held a meeting with Chairman Chey Tae-won and other key figures from the business community.
This meeting was organized to explain to the business community the importance of the 'social dialogue platform,' which Speaker Woo presented as a key role of the 22nd National Assembly, and to enhance mutual communication on economic issues.
Alongside Speaker Woo, major members of the National Assembly attended, while Chairman Chey was joined by 14 other chairpersons from KCCI.
Chairman Chey Tae-won stated, "In a situation where competition between countries in advanced industries is intense, our companies also want to do their best to secure competitiveness on the global stage," requesting support from the government and the National Assembly.
He also emphasized that the economic community, government, and National Assembly must work together to solve national challenges such as the climate crisis and low birthrate issues.
In response, Speaker Woo Won-shik said, "It is very positive that companies are making efforts to approach the public," and promised to strengthen cooperation between KCCI and the National Assembly.
He also highlighted that social dialogue is an essential element in resolving complex conflicts and stated that they will continue to communicate with the business community.
Meanwhile, in-depth discussions were held on policy tasks for strengthening global competitiveness and strategies for maintaining a technological edge in advanced technologies. KCCI shared future strategies by distributing the newly published book "First Mover Advantage" to the attendees.
